Chosen for National Simultaneous Storytime 2026, Luna Roo the Kangaroo Baller delivers a high-energy story that will have you cheering like you’re in the stands

Luna leaves nothing on the pitch as she steps up to lead FC Outback in a thrilling face-off against Bush United, learning to silence her doubts, believe in her skills and trust her teammates.

Book one in the Animal World Cup series, Luna Roo the Kangaroo Baller is an inspiring underdog tale of courage, perseverance and determination.

National Simultaneous Storytime 2026

The Australian Library and Information Association (ALIA) have selected Luna Roo the Kangaroo Baller as the official picture book for National Simultaneous Storytime in 2026.

Adam Jackson

Adam Jackson has worked in football for nearly 20 years, starting his career at Manchester United then moving to Australia to work in sports publishing, most notably leading the sales and marketing for football magazine FourFourTwo. He is currently the Head of Marketing at global sports broadcaster beIN SPORTS, who broadcast European football in Australia and New Zealand.

Adrian Lloyd

Adrian Lloyd has played football for over 40 years and is a FA qualified coach, having coached children in America, at Fulham FC in London and both adult and children's teams in Australia. Adrian has also spent the last 20 years working in publishing, marketing and digital advertising for major global publishers and brands.

Jake A Minton

Jake A Minton is an illustrator and graphic novelist living in Melbourne with his cat. After being shortlisted for the Little Hare Illustration Prize in 2020, he has gone on to create CBCA recognised picture books There's No Such Book and Two Turtles. Jake is also the illustrator of the bestselling graphic novel Inked and the popular junior-fiction series Zombie Diaries. In 2025, he was awarded first prize in the Established Illustrator category of the SCBWI Australian Picture Book Illustrator Award.
